Bayer 04 Leverkusen is looking to cause an upset in the Champions League by defeating FC Bayern, following their impressive 4:1 victory over Eintracht Frankfurt. The team's recent performance has been promising, with Granit Xhaka and Xabi Alonso expressing optimism about their chances against the reigning champions. Xhaka stated that they are "stabil genug, um Bayern nächste Woche zu ärgern," which translates to "stable enough to annoy Bayern next week."
The Werkself has been in good form lately, with eight consecutive games without a loss, and Xabi Alonso believes that this momentum can be carried into the Champions League match. However, he also acknowledged that the Champions League is a different competition from the Bundesliga, requiring emotional control and a strong mental game. The team's ability to maintain their composure under pressure will be crucial in determining the outcome of the match. Additionally, their tactical approach will need to be spot on to outmaneuver their opponents.
In their previous encounter, Bayer Leverkusen dominated the match but was unable to secure a win, resulting in a 0:0 draw. Xabi Alonso has a good record against his former club, with three wins and three draws in six games. The team is looking to build on this success and cause an upset in the Champions League.
